I'd recommend observing a leo (or several). It's the best way to see what they're like. If you find a good breeder nearby, they should let you look at their setup, let you watch them for a bit, and let you watch feeding. That would give you the best idea.

If you're debating leo vs. beardie, I've seen beardies who seem to love being petted/scratched under their chin. But my leo will have nothing of that. At least not yet.

Either way, every lizard is different. If you decide on a leo, pick one out of the group that seems energetic, active, and goes after food with enthusiasm.
